Received: by 2002:ac0:e350:0:0:0:0:0 with SMTP id g16csp783262imn; Sat, 30 Jul 2022 02:57:46 -0700 (PDT) X-Google-Smtp-Source: AA6agR6Q2kSB4wMqmoE1xgKzNZr5HvCbhqDiFjrr++qK37XedNa/TZoMx7kNwtIaTcyJOzH3VhAP X-Received: by 2002:a17:90a:bf09:b0:1f3:b19:ce9f with SMTP id c9-20020a17090abf0900b001f30b19ce9fmr8450451pjs.71.1659175065786; Sat, 30 Jul 2022 02:57:45 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1659175065; cv=none; d=google.com; s=arc-20160816; b=G+AWmVhprunDvJqURxO1pHIkSP3VU1XRjTIGMG5TUWW+slyqwb68o1PUEBfty6QB4E +4yE/CxnwXDopWPZxipASrIKiCe8u1Vzq86fZvu/ag/ZEKXdhi6dPNw86i9n6zrxGFu7 13pHiXj51phswn1RN/KvKUI6KFAU1htMKY8Yusi5QR0EAqd75QurJ4LZ0jb3PaHhqtx6 Nn261/BeH4qw2GTq285NoC4gfqTNQQ+CuzbAcs9STdbbHDoFiiCqe49Nfh7Hc8jykvxy TCxLmzsidOk/JG0WYdSm9JlEghUt181FzN9JkqAj/scNwc94ReYJzvQ3Mi0GZ2262pZc ybHg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:user-agent:in-reply-to:content-disposition :mime-version:references:message-id:subject:cc:to:from:date :dkim-signature:dkim-signature; bh=weCa4etYCrU0JKpJO/Ui+2clGa/1cbP+1Ce8uxB4Z2U=; b=B65WK9WAmbFk848WC/1wKNf5LmsDy6NqY9JV5GyAz2MWTw9hqjf7g1v37FW3e10791 jx1iMm8VTaQ7eYJQ0TfnulRHfFceJnxKpdxNgON3z11RdKNc1fvUc3Iltw9Wb/GO+2B/ x4GNpJKGVL+TnGvTXZuorLLkeg3I/bb73nV7sI3ScePxLYNGiQdIdRIRIcB1JOHpgLtR mAN+fslpLsqAg/WXP84xVZiGiDMkm5JduicLkbls7R0DsohSoY4Fnwg2MNzxmD8Qk5Y6 Z9nwELWGmuSsMZyaCPyazLblZ2QS9nl8wN/qG4NSp7higcGTxQXbOcxv6on2X+J5LeXR hsNg== ARC-Authentication-Results: i=1; mx.google.com; dkim=neutral (no key) header.i=@lespinasse.org header.s=srv-79-ed header.b="x/Ziq42G"; dkim=pass (test mode) header.i=@lespinasse.org header.s=srv-79-rsa header.b=xjlyRJ2P;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=lespinasse.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id q7-20020a170902dac700b0016d4411b360si5230520plx.450.2022.07.30.02.57.31; Sat, 30 Jul 2022 02:57:45 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=neutral (no key) header.i=@lespinasse.org header.s=srv-79-ed header.b="x/Ziq42G"; dkim=pass (test mode) header.i=@lespinasse.org header.s=srv-79-rsa header.b=xjlyRJ2P;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=lespinasse.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S234043AbiG3Jku (ORCPT + 99 others); Sat, 30 Jul 2022 05:40:50 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:40612 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S234181AbiG3Jkn (ORCPT ); Sat, 30 Jul 2022 05:40:43 -0400 Received: from server.lespinasse.org (server.lespinasse.org [63.205.204.226]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 2888B11446; Sat, 30 Jul 2022 02:40:32 -0700 (PDT) DKIM-Signature: v=1; a=ed25519-sha256; c=relaxed/relaxed; d=lespinasse.org; i=@lespinasse.org; q=dns/txt; s=srv-79-ed; t=1659174032; h=date : from : to : cc : subject : message-id : references : mime-version : content-type : in-reply-to : from; bh=weCa4etYCrU0JKpJO/Ui+2clGa/1cbP+1Ce8uxB4Z2U=; b=x/Ziq42GBYdLObjVTEjRxMr42JGNj1S6ikUonHkCSS9+QUAEIEusirhrUb1NLAhWCN9I/ 26gXmKmVFCvOvm8Ag==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=lespinasse.org; i=@lespinasse.org; q=dns/txt; s=srv-79-rsa; t=1659174032; h=date : from : to : cc : subject : message-id : references : mime-version : content-type : in-reply-to : from; bh=weCa4etYCrU0JKpJO/Ui+2clGa/1cbP+1Ce8uxB4Z2U=; b=xjlyRJ2PLCvlHddIpET9xkdQ9b2YJIlAuRmqVD4Zi9LYcfMqzgs3mU4rkm/FKHLXNUOaJ LyyP89/nFeA6CHdOEfvoMWe+2hvIc5qWIl7OAgthzIj8J1BY1lyEpfvyFmhVmffdeRhfjdo vMuxuuddA8OZu54a34mTh9dLsyNfUY1VEPbkQXmB5bXD5tY51a2x0Dy7lPzCrgrdbPY9jea g6bR8AptJZSZjsf3hgGuxahRdvKbF0nVgvjROX7b4fAX0R64UDLs/zIoRFldyB9Yfr1EawK tm9ki9L5Z6WkfftzLymxjgxhP/KXmf4WU+QM/fsd13mCq3dze1SIRx1wUOGA== Received: by server.lespinasse.org (Postfix, from userid 1000) id 1452116096D; Sat, 30 Jul 2022 02:40:32 -0700 (PDT) Date: Sat, 30 Jul 2022 02:40:32 -0700 From: Michel Lespinasse To: "Paul E. McKenney" Cc: Michel Lespinasse , Peter Zijlstra , rth@twiddle.net, ink@jurassic.park.msu.ru, mattst88@gmail.com, vgupta@kernel.org, linux@armlinux.org.uk, ulli.kroll@googlemail.com, linus.walleij@linaro.org, shawnguo@kernel.org, Sascha Hauer , kernel@pengutronix.de, festevam@gmail.com, linux-imx@nxp.com, tony@atomide.com, khilman@kernel.org, catalin.marinas@arm.com, will@kernel.org, guoren@kernel.org, bcain@quicinc.com, chenhuacai@kernel.org, kernel@xen0n.name, geert@linux-m68k.org, sammy@sammy.net, monstr@monstr.eu, tsbogend@alpha.franken.de, dinguyen@kernel.org, jonas@southpole.se, stefan.kristiansson@saunalahti.fi, shorne@gmail.com, James.Bottomley@HansenPartnership.com, deller@gmx.de, mpe@ellerman.id.au, benh@kernel.crashing.org, paulus@samba.org, paul.walmsley@sifive.com, palmer@dabbelt.com, aou@eecs.berkeley.edu, hca@linux.ibm.com, gor@linux.ibm.com, agordeev@linux.ibm.com, borntraeger@linux.ibm.com, svens@linux.ibm.com, ysato@users.sourceforge.jp, dalias@libc.org, davem@davemloft.net, richard@nod.at, anton.ivanov@cambridgegreys.com, johannes@sipsolutions.net, tglx@linutronix.de, mingo@redhat.com, bp@alien8.de, dave.hansen@linux.intel.com, x86@kernel.org, hpa@zytor.com, acme@kernel.org, mark.rutland@arm.com, alexander.shishkin@linux.intel.com, jolsa@kernel.org, namhyung@kernel.org, jgross@suse.com, srivatsa@csail.mit.edu, amakhalov@vmware.com, pv-drivers@vmware.com, boris.ostrovsky@oracle.com, chris@zankel.net, jcmvbkbc@gmail.com, rafael@kernel.org, lenb@kernel.org, pavel@ucw.cz, gregkh@linuxfoundation.org, mturquette@baylibre.com, sboyd@kernel.org, daniel.lezcano@linaro.org, lpieralisi@kernel.org, sudeep.holla@arm.com, agross@kernel.org, bjorn.andersson@linaro.org, anup@brainfault.org, thierry.reding@gmail.com, jonathanh@nvidia.com, jacob.jun.pan@linux.intel.com, Arnd Bergmann , yury.norov@gmail.com, andriy.shevchenko@linux.intel.com, linux@rasmusvillemoes.dk, rostedt@goodmis.org, pmladek@suse.com, senozhatsky@chromium.org, john.ogness@linutronix.de, frederic@kernel.org, quic_neeraju@quicinc.com, josh@joshtriplett.org, mathieu.desnoyers@efficios.com, jiangshanlai@gmail.com, joel@joelfernandes.org, juri.lelli@redhat.com, vincent.guittot@linaro.org, dietmar.eggemann@arm.com, bsegall@google.com, mgorman@suse.de, bristot@redhat.com, vschneid@redhat.com, jpoimboe@kernel.org, linux-alpha@vger.kernel.org, linux-kernel@vger.kernel.org, linux-snps-arc@lists.infradead.org, linux-arm-kernel@lists.infradead.org, linux-omap@vger.kernel.org, linux-csky@vger.kernel.org, linux-hexagon@vger.kernel.org, linux-ia64@vger.kernel.org, linux-m68k@lists.linux-m68k.org, linux-mips@vger.kernel.org, openrisc@lists.librecores.org, linux-parisc@vger.kernel.org, linuxppc-dev@lists.ozlabs.org, linux-riscv@lists.infradead.org, linux-s390@vger.kernel.org, linux-sh@vger.kernel.org, sparclinux@vger.kernel.org, linux-um@lists.infradead.org, linux-perf-users@vger.kernel.org, virtualization@lists.linux-foundation.org, xen-devel@lists.xenproject.org, linux-xtensa@linux-xtensa.org, linux-acpi@vger.kernel.org, linux-pm@vger.kernel.org, linux-clk@vger.kernel.org, linux-arm-msm@vger.kernel.org, linux-tegra@vger.kernel.org, linux-arch@vger.kernel.org, rcu@vger.kernel.org, rh0@fb.com Subject: Re: [PATCH 04/36] cpuidle,intel_idle: Fix CPUIDLE_FLAG_IRQ_ENABLE Message-ID: <20220730094032.GA1587@lespinasse.org> References: <20220608142723.103523089@infradead.org> <20220608144516.172460444@infradead.org> <20220725194306.GA14746@lespinasse.org> <20220728172053.GA3607379@paulmck-ThinkPad-P17-Gen-1> <20220729102458.GA1695@lespinasse.org> <20220729152622.GM2860372@paulmck-ThinkPad-P17-Gen-1>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20220729152622.GM2860372@paulmck-ThinkPad-P17-Gen-1> User-Agent: Mutt/1.10.1 (2018-07-13) X-Spam-Status: No, score=-2.1 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_NONE, SPF_HELO_PASS,SPF_PASS autolearn=unavailable aut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Fri, Jul 29, 2022 at 08:26:22AM -0700, Paul E. McKenney wrote:> Would you be willing to try another shot in the dark, but untested > this time? I freely admit that this is getting strange. > > Thanx, Paul Yes, adding this second change got rid of the boot time warning for me. > ------------------------------------------------------------------------ > > diff --git a/kernel/sched/clock.c b/kernel/sched/clock.c > index e374c0c923dae..279f557bf60bb 100644 > --- a/kernel/sched/clock.c > +++ b/kernel/sched/clock.c > @@ -394,7 +394,7 @@ notrace void sched_clock_tick(void) > if (!static_branch_likely(&sched_clock_running)) > return; > > - lockdep_assert_irqs_disabled(); > + WARN_ON_ONCE(IS_ENABLED(CONFIG_RCU_EQS_DEBUG) && !raw_irqs_disabled()); > > scd = this_scd(); > __scd_stamp(scd);